Abstract

High-spin levels in208Po, populated in the208Pb(α,4n)-reaction, were studied usingα-particles in the energy region 41–51 MeV. The energies of levels above the 6+ level have an uncertainty of about 10 keV due to the fact that the 8+→6+ transition has not been observed so far, but this transition has previously been established to be converted neither in theK-shell nor in theL-shells. It was found that the yrast cascade ofγ-rays from a 19+ level at 5896+ε keV feeds levels of lower spin which all can be explained as originating from two proton-two neutron hole configurations. In the higher part of the cascade it is mainly the neutron holes which change their configuration, while the lower part of the cascade is dominated by changes in the proton configuration. The yrast levels in the angular momentum regionJ=8–19 vary practically linearly with energy in the region 1.5–6 MeV. No isomeric traps were found above the 11 level at 2699+ε keV.
